/*
* Check for dialup password
*
* dialcheck tests to see if tty is listed as being a dialup
* line. If so, a dialup password may be required if the shell
* is listed as one which requires a second password.
*/
int
dialcheck(const char *tty, const char *sh)
{
struct dialup *dialup;
char *pass;
char *cp;
setduent ();
if (! isadialup (tty)) {
endduent ();
return (1);
}
if (! (dialup = getdushell (sh))) {
endduent ();
return (1);
}
endduent ();
if (dialup->du_passwd[0] == '\0')
return (1);
if (! (pass = getpass(_("Dialup Password:"))))
return (0);
cp = pw_encrypt (pass, dialup->du_passwd);
strzero(pass);
return (strcmp (cp, dialup->du_passwd) == 0);
}
